Types of Keys Primary Key
Attribute that uniquely identifies a row or a record
Secondary KeyNon-unique field that is used as a
secondary (alternate) key Concatenate Key
Consists of two or more data elements or attributes
Types of Keys
Control Key Used to physically
sequence the stored data Foreign Key
An attribute in a table whose values must match a primary key in another table
